Enzyme Information

1.5.1.7
Saccharopine dehydrogenase (NAD(+), L-lysine-forming).
based on mapping to UniProt P38998
N(6)-(L-1,3-dicarboxypropyl)-L-lysine + NAD(+) + H(2)O = L-lysine + 2-oxoglutarate + NADH.
